Output 8deab7535891a5946207bc0507a8712cc82f705589c4360b12bdb22deb21a5a9:18

value
83908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479af17287e9d35990ca01e2b36bf5f25a139008 OP_EQUAL
address
38DdWoWoD57kFWYER65JkonJR1XesiHpz1
transaction
8deab7535891a5946207bc0507a8712cc82f705589c4360b12bdb22deb21a5a9
spent
true